Abstract
Introduction Squamous cell carcinoma (SCC) of the maxillary alveolus is a relatively rare disease. There is lack of data on this subsite as compared with other sites. The factors that affect survival in cases of maxillary alveolar SCC are tumor stage, local and cervical metastases, histological grading, and the margin status. Objectives To evaluate the overall survival (OS), the disease free survival (DFS), and the complex interaction and effects of margin status, histological differentiation, habits (such as smoking and the use of smokeless tobacco products), and cervical and distant metastases based on clinicopathological data. Methods We examined the electronic database at our hospital from 2003 to 2017. We included all cases with a histopathological diagnosis of SCC of the maxillary alveolus. Tumors originating primarily from the maxillary alveolus were included, while those originating from adjacent subsites, like the hard palate, the buccal mucosa or the maxillary sinus were excluded. We also excluded all the patients who were not operated on with a curative intent. Results More than half of the patients had stage-IV tumors at the time of presentation, while only one fourth of them had nodal metastasis. The rate of recurrence increased in cases of primary tumors in advanced stages and the degree of histological differentiation. The 2-year and 5-year OS rates were of 54.5% (18 patients) and 30.3% (10 patients) respectively. Conclusion Primary tumors in advanced stages, histological grade, and presence of nodal metastasis are poor prognostic markers in terms of long-term survival.

Abstract
A 74-year-old male with a history of mild cognitive impairment presented to the emergency department with failure to thrive and generalized weakness. He was having difficulty swallowing leading to 30 pounds of unintentional weight loss in the last three months. His social history was significant for 12.5 pack-year smoking and drinking (two to three glasses of wine/day). The oral cavity examination revealed a large (3 × 2 cm2) defect with the erythematous border that encompassed the mid-palatal structures and emanated from the hard palate into his nasal cavity. Auto-immune work-up was negative. Palatal biopsy showed squamous cell carcinoma (SCC; well-differentiated). A diagnosis of locally advanced (stage IVa) oral cavity squamous cell carcinoma (OSCC) was made based on PET scan findings. A palatal obturator (prosthesis) was placed to improve his eating, prevent regurgitation. The patient opted for palliative care and did not want to pursue further treatment. He was discharged home with a regular follow-up visit.

Abstract
Background Management of the node‐negative neck in oral maxillary squamous cell carcinoma (SCC), encompassing the hard palate and upper alveolar subsites of the oral cavity, is controversial, with no clear international consensus or recommendation regarding elective neck dissection in the absence of cervical metastases. Aim To assess the occult metastatic rate in patients with clinically node negative oral maxillary SCC; both as an overall metastatic rate, and a comparison of patients managed with an elective neck dissection at index surgery, compared to excision of the primary with clinical observation of the neck. Methods and results A systematic review was performed by two independent investigators for studies relating to oral maxillary SCC and analysed according to PRISMA criteria. Data were extracted from Pubmed, Ovid MEDLINE, EMBASE, and SCOPUS via relevant MeSH terms. Grey literature was searched through Google Scholar and OpenGrey. Five hundred and fifty‐three articles were identified on the initial search, 483 unique articles underwent screening against eligibility criteria, and 29 studies were identified for final data extraction. Incidence of occult metastases in patients with clinically node negative oral maxillary SCC was identified either on primary elective neck dissection or on routine follow up. Meta‐analyses were performed. Of 553 relevant articles identified on initial search, 29 were included for analysis. The pooled overall rate of occult metastases in patients initially presenting with clinically node‐negative disease was 22.2%. There is a statistically significant effect of END on decreasing regional recurrence demonstrated in this study (RR 0.36, 95% CI 0.24, 0.59). Conclusion The results of this systematic review and meta‐analysis suggest elective neck dissection for patients presenting with hard palate or upper alveolar SCC, even in a clinically node negative neck.

Abstract
BACKGROUND AND OBJECTIVES The reported risk of nodal metastasis in hard palate and upper gingival squamous cell carcinoma (SCC) has been inconsistent with inadequate consensus regarding the utility of neck dissection in the clinically negative (cN0) neck. MATERIALS AND METHODS Using the National Cancer Database, cN0 patients diagnosed with SCC of the head and neck with the subsites of the hard palate and upper gingiva were identified from 2004 to 2014. RESULTS A total of 1830 patients were identified, and END was performed on 422 patients with cN0 tumors. Pathologically positive nodes occurred in 14% (59/422) of patients in this cohort. Higher tumor stage, academic hospital type, and large hospital volume (>28 cancer-specific cases/year) were associated with a higher likelihood of END both in univariate and multivariate analyses (P < .05). Patients >80 years of age were less likely to receive END on multivariate analysis (OR 0.52, 0.32-0.84). No variables, including advanced T stage, predicted occult metastases. Cox proportional hazards regression analysis showed that patients who underwent END demonstrated improved OS over an 11-year period (hazard ratio 0.75, P = .002). On subgroup analysis, this improvement was significant in patients with both stage T1 and T4 tumors. CONCLUSIONS Tumor stage, hospital type, and hospital volume were associated with higher rates of END for patients with cN0 hard palate SCC and after controlling for clinical factors, END was associated with improved overall survival.

Abstract
Background The aim of this study was to evaluate the efficacy and safety of carbon‐ion radiation therapy for nonsquamous cell carcinomas of the oral cavity in a multicenter study. Methods Retrospective analysis of the clinicopathological features and outcomes of 76 patients with oral nonsquamous cell carcinomas with N0‐1 M0 status and were treated with carbon‐ion radiation therapy at four institutions in Japan between November 2003 and December 2014 was performed. Results Salivary gland carcinoma, mucosal melanoma, and three other carcinomas were found in 46, 27, and 3 patients, respectively. T1‐3, T4a, and T4b disease was diagnosed in 27, 18, and 31 patients, respectively. Median follow‐up period was 31.1 months (range, 3‐118 months). Three‐year local control, progression‐free survival, and overall survival of all patients were 86.8%, 63.1%, and 78.4%, respectively. Multivariate analysis showed T classification (T4) to be a significant independent poor prognostic factor for local control. Acute grade 3 mucositis was observed in 38 patients. Grades 3 and 4 late morbidities were observed in 9 and 4 patients, respectively. No grade 5 late toxicity was observed. Conclusions Oral nonsquamous cell carcinomas could be treated effectively, with acceptable toxicity, by carbon‐ion radiation therapy.

Abstract
Background This study evaluated carbon‐ion radiotherapy (C‐ion RT) for oral non‐squamous cell carcinomas (non‐SCC). Methods We retrospectively obtained data from 74 patients who underwent C‐ion RT for oral malignancies between April 1997 and March 2016. The C‐ion RT was administered in 16 fractions at a total dose of 57.6 or 64.0 Gy (relative biological effectiveness). Results Forty‐three patients had salivary gland carcinomas, 29 patients had mucosal melanoma, and 2 patients had other types of pathologies. The tumors were classified as T1‐T3 (24 cases), T4a (21 cases), or T4b (29 cases). The median follow‐up was 49 months. The 5‐year rates were 78.8% for local control, 36.2% for progression‐free survival, and 58.3% for overall survival. Although 10 patients developed grade 3 osteoradionecrosis after C‐ion RT, all patients maintained their mastication and deglutition functions after sequestrectomy and prosthesis placement. Conclusion C‐ion RT was effective for oral non‐SCC and had acceptable toxicities.

Abstract
BACKGROUND To define the prognostic factors associated with outcome in patients with soft palate squamous cell carcinoma (SCC). METHODS Previously untreated patients with soft palate and uvula SCC treated in our institution between 1997 and 2012 were collected. The prognostic value of clinical, hematological, and treatment characteristics was examined. RESULTS We identified 156 patients, median age 58 years, with 71% drinkers, 91% smokers; 19% had synchronous cancer. Front-line treatment was chemoradiotherapy in 58 (37%), radiotherapy alone in 60 (39%), surgery in 17 (11%), and induction chemotherapy in 21 patients (14%). The 5-year actuarial overall survival (OS) and progression-free survival (PFS) were 41% and 37%, respectively. In univariate analysis, T3-T4 vs T1-T2 stage, N2-N3 vs N0-N1 stage, and neutrophil count >7 g/L were associated with worse OS and PFS (P < .05). CONCLUSION In patients with soft palate SCC, inflammation biomarkers were associated with OS.

Abstract
PURPOSE The main aim of the present study is to analyze the behavior of squamous cell carcinoma (SCC) of maxillary gingiva, alveolus, and hard palate and to determine the utility of selective neck dissection in clinically N0 patients at early stages. MATERIAL AND METHOD Twenty-nine previously untreated patients with SCC of maxillary gingiva, alveolus, and hard palate were diagnosed and treated with at least a tumorectomy and selective neck dissection at HUVN and included in the study. RESULTS A total of 34.4% of patients (10/29) showed nodal involvement at postoperative histopathologic exam. Several pathologic features such as N involvement, N stage, T stage, and locoregional failure all have a negative impact on overall survival. DISCUSSION SCC of maxillary gingiva, alveolus, and hard palate shows an aggressive behavior that is comparable with other oral cavity cancers. A more aggressive treatment is thus required for improving locoregional control and overall survival. Supraomohyoid neck dissection may be useful in cT2N0M0.

Abstract
OBJECTIVE To describe the incidence and determinants of survival of patients with squamous cell carcinoma of the hard palate (SCCHP) between the years of 1973 to 2014 using the Surveillance, Epidemiology, and End Results (SEER) database. METHODS Retrospective, population-based cohort study of patients in the SEER tumor registry who were diagnosed with SCCHP from 1973 to 2014. Outcomes and measures included overall survival (OS) and disease-specific survival (DSS). RESULTS A total of 1,489 cases of primary SCCHP were identified. Of those, 53.2% were females and 47.8% presented with stage IV disease. The mean age at diagnosis was 69.8 years. Overall survival at 2, 5, and 10 years was 44%, 33%, and 21%, respectively. A total of 66.2% of patients underwent surgery (with or without radiation therapy [RT]); 20.1% received RT; and 22.4% had both surgical and RT. On multivariate analysis, RT, advanced age, stage, and grade were associated with worse OS and DSS (P < 0.05). Surgical therapy (with or without radiation) was an independent favorable predictor of OS and DSS (P < 0.05). CONCLUSION SCCHP is relatively infrequent tumor that portends an overall poor prognosis when advanced stage and a greater prognosis when early stage. Surgical therapy was found to be an independent predictor for improved OS and DSS, whereas RT was associated with reduced OS and DSS. LEVEL OF EVIDENCE 4. Laryngoscope, 128:2050-2055, 2018.

Abstract
PURPOSE The literature and experience of high-dose-rate (HDR) surface mould brachytherapy (SMB) in head and neck cancer is sparse. We report our institutional experience of SMB for such tumours. MATERIAL AND METHODS Thirty-five patients with malignant localized early T1/T2, N0 (21 intra-oral and 14 skin) tumours treated with SMB during 2008-2014 were analyzed. Treatment was delivered using HDR 192Ir source to a median dose of 49 Gy (range, 38.5-52.5 Gy) as radical brachytherapy and 18 Gy (range, 15.5-30 Gy) as boost with 3-4 Gy/fraction twice daily using customized surface mould. RESULTS Median follow-up was 52 months (range, 6 to 98 months). Local control (LC) for skin tumours and intra-oral malignancies at 5 years were 92% and 76%, respectively. Five-year cause specific survival was 92%. For T1 and T2 tumours, 5 year LC was 94.2% and 68.2%, respectively. T stage (p < 0.04) and dose/fractions (p < 0.003) were the only significant prognostic factors for LC on univariate analysis. CONCLUSIONS Surface mould brachytherapy results in excellent LC rates for skin tumours and T1 intraoral tumours when considered as radical treatment, and preferable to consider it as a boost for T2 intraoral tumours. Surface mould brachytherapy results in excellent organ and function preservation.

Abstract
PURPOSE Minor salivary gland cancers are rare and account for roughly 2% to 3% of all head and neck tumors. This is a retrospective review in a modern cohort of patients treated for this rare cancer with surgery and adjuvant radiation therapy. MATERIALS AND METHODS Between February 1990 and December 2010, 98 patients with cancer of the minor salivary glands were identified and treated at a single institution. The median radiation dose was 63 Gy. Outcomes assessed included local control (LC), locoregional control (LRC), and overall survival (OS). Toxicity was graded using the Common Terminology Criteria for Adverse Events, version 3.0. Competing-risk analysis using the Gray test was performed, with death as the competing risk. OS was calculated by the Kaplan-Meier method. RESULTS With a median follow-up of 7.3 years, the 5- and 10-year LC and LRC rates were 87.9% and 83%, and 80.5% and 73.7%, respectively. Higher T stage and adenocarcinoma histology were the significant negative prognostic factors for both LC and LRC. Freedom from distant metastasis at 5 and 10 years were 83% and 63%, respectively. The median OS was 19.6 years. Overall, no grade 4 or 5 toxicities occurred, and 20% of the cohort experienced an acute grade 3 toxicity, and 6% with a grade 3 late toxicity. CONCLUSIONS In a modern cohort treated with surgery and radiotherapy, excellent outcomes can be achieved with lower toxicity rates compared with older published series.

Abstract
OBJECTIVES/HYPOTHESIS Hard palate and maxillary alveolus are two commonly grouped oral cavity subsites due to their anatomic contiguity and oncologic disease behavior. Few studies have been conducted investigating clinical presentation, staging, prevalence of cervical metastases, and outcomes in this population. The primary objective of this study was to analyze predictors of disease-free survival (DFS) in surgically treated patients, particularly as it relates to the role of neck dissection. STUDY DESIGN Cohort study with planned data collection. METHODS This cohort study used planned data collection over 15 years (1994-2008) at a large tertiary care cancer center to study all patients presenting with squamous cell carcinoma of the maxillary alveolus and hard palate treated surgically. Univariate and multivariate Cox regression analyses were used to identify predictors of DFS. RESULTS Ninety-seven patients met the inclusion criteria (54 male, 56%). The majority of patients (54, 56%) presented with locally advanced disease (cT3, cT4). Occult nodal metastases were noted in 26% (17 of 65) of patients clinically staged as N0. The 3-year DFS was 70% (95% confidence interval = 59%-78%) with a median time to failure of 1.1 years (range = 0.3-9.7 years). Cox regression multivariate model demonstrated that advanced pathologic T stage, hard palate tumor site, and poorly differentiated tumor grade were each independent predictors of DFS. CONCLUSIONS A significant portion of the patients with hard palate and maxillary alveolus tumors harbor occult cervical metastases. Elective neck dissection in the high-risk patients may potentially be beneficial in providing more accurate staging and improving DFS. LEVEL OF EVIDENCE 2b.

Abstract
Aim: To evaluate the efficacy of elective neck dissection versus the “wait and watch” policy in the treatment of early squamous cell carcinoma of tongue. Materials and Methods: This is a retrospective study of 21 patients with surgical treatment between April 2009 and July 2011. The patients were divided into two groups, with Group 1 consisting of patients who underwent wide excision glossectomy with elective neck dissection and Group 2 consisting of patients who underwent glossectomy without the neck being surgically addressed. The selection of patients was done by the random double-blinded method and the review was done by a single reviewer. All patients were examined for an average period of 1 year postoperatively. Results: Twenty-one cases were treated, among which there were 17 T1 and 4 T2 carcinomas. All the patients had primary carcinoma involving only the tongue with no clinical neck palpable neck nodes. Eleven patients underwent wide excision of primary tumor with elective neck dissection (Group 1) and 10 patients underwent only resection of primary tumor without the neck being surgically addressed (Group 2). In Group 1, there were no recurrences, and in Group 2, there were two patients who developed subsequent cervical node metastasis with one patient undergoing further surgery to address the positive neck and the other patient was lost to follow-up. Conclusions: Regional recurrence was the most common cause of failure after surgical treatment of oral tongue carcinoma. Elective neck dissection significantly reduced mortality due to regional recurrence and also increased the overall survival. Our study suggests that elective neck dissection is a treatment strategy of choice for stages I and II carcinoma of the oral tongue. A prospective, randomized study is worthwhile to further evaluate the benefit of elective neck dissection in the treatment of early carcinoma of the tongue with a larger pool of patients and a lengthier follow-up period.

Abstract
Oral squamous cell carcinoma is one of the most frequent types of head and neck cancers in Japan. Although recent reports have shown positive results of non-surgical treatment for advanced head and neck squamous cell carcinoma, including tongue cancer, no clear treatment strategies have been established for oral cancers, except for tongue cancer. To assess appropriate therapies, we conducted a retrospective chart review of 114 Japanese patients with oral cancers that were pathologically diagnosed as squamous cell carcinoma, excluding tongue cancers. The overall and the disease specific 5-year survival rates were 53% and 61%, respectively. Univariate and multivariate analyses revealed a lower stage (I, II, or III) and non-surgical treatment as good and poor prognostic factors of oral squamous cell carcinoma, respectively, based on their hazard ratios of 0.17 (95% CI 0.045-0.60, p = 0.0061) and 5.3 (95% CI 2.7-11, p < 0.0001). Furthermore, impact of surgery was well documented in the operable stage IVa cancers (p = 0.00015). The surgical treatment consisted of the wide resection of the primary tumor and the neck dissection for stage III or IV tumors. The present data also suggest that adjunctive therapy, such as post-operative radiation therapy or post-operative chemo-radiation therapy, shows no survival benefit compared to the surgery alone. We therefore recommend the surgical treatment for advanced oral squamous cell carcinoma in Japanese patients. These results would be helpful in future clinical trials, especially in non-surgical treatment studies of oral squamous cell carcinoma in Japan.

Abstract
Maxillary cancers include neoplasms arising in both maxillary sinus and oral cavity (upper alveolar ridge, hard palate) according to the American Joint Committee on Cancer. Although it is universally accepted that the combination of surgery and radiotherapy seems to be the treatment of choice, there is no accordance about the treatment of clinically negative neck. We retrospectively analyzed 20 patients with maxillary sinus cancer and 37 with an upper alveolar ridge or hard palate cancer, evaluating the incidence of N-disease and the recurrence at local site. On the basis of our findings, we can affirm that elective treatment of the neck in maxillary carcinoma is not recommended. Considering only squamous cell carcinoma, cervical node metastases are most frequent in case of tumors staged as T1 o T2. High-grade squamous cell carcinomas seem to be related to a higher incidence of nodal involvement. T recurrence has demonstrated to be the most frequent neoplastic event, so that radical surgery is considered one of the most important prognostic factors. Nevertheless, other prospective studies are necessary.

Abstract
OBJECTIVE This population-based historical cohort study evaluates the treatment outcomes of primary squamous cell carcinoma of the maxillary alveolus and hard palate. METHODS A historical cohort of 37 cases of previously untreated biopsy-proven squamous cell carcinoma of the upper jaw registered in the Province of Manitoba from January 1975 to January 2004 was analyzed. RESULTS The tumor epicenter involved the maxillary alveolus in 26 patients and the hard palate in 11 patients. The mean age of the study population was 72.8 years and 67% were women with a documented tobacco use rate of 50%. Forty-one percent had stage I or II disease, 51% stage III or IV, and 8% could not be staged. Treatment included radiotherapy as a single modality (13.5%), surgery (38%), surgery and radiotherapy (24%), and palliative treatment (24%). Local recurrence was observed in 10 patients with 6 failing at the primary site. The absolute and disease-free survival at 5 years was 33% and 62% respectively. The 5-year disease-free survival was 82% for stage I and II and 48% for stage III and IV (P = .056). No patient treated with radiotherapy as a single treatment modality survived 5 years. Disease-free survival for patients treated with surgery, and surgery +/- radiotherapy, was 69% and 73% at 5 years, respectively (P = .001). CONCLUSIONS Squamous cell carcinoma of the maxillary alveolus and palate differs from other oral cancers in that the patients are relatively older with a slight female predilection. Treatment with surgery, with or without radiotherapy, appears to improve disease control.

Abstract
PURPOSE The aim of this retrospective study was to determine a rational of treatment of squamous-cell carcinoma of the upper gum and hard palate. PATIENTS AND METHOD We analyzed retrospectively a series of 34 patients treated over a period of 11 years. RESULTS There were 19 women (76%); mean age was 67.3 years; 76% had advanced tumors; 28% had neck nodes. The 5-year survival rate was 33.7%; patients without node involvement had better prognosis (p=0.034). The 5-year rate of recurrence-free survival was 61%; patients without node involvement had better prognosis (p = 0.032). At the end of the study, only 42% of patients were still alive. DISCUSSION This type of tumor is different from those of other locations in the oral cavity or oropharynx. At the present time, surgery associated or not with post-operative radiotherapy seems to be optimal curative treatment. The question of whether neck dissection should be performed remains debated for patients without clinically nodes.
